Ubuntu review
What do you like best about the product?
It is free of cost and easily accessible. Provides access to many applications like slack, firefox, telegram and skype. Very less malware and almost no antivirus is required since it does not allow pirated software.
What do you dislike about the product?
The number of applications that we can install on Ubuntu is limited. We cannot access MS office and some other important windows based applications. It needs proper tech-savvy people to understand and work on.
What problems is the product solving and how is that benefiting you?
Used it for various development and coding purpose on daily basis. Using it for the day-to-day maintenance and meetings on skype and slack. Use it for surfing and UI experience which is much better than windows.

Freedom to customize
What do you like best about the product?
I like its performance and open source makes it so reliable for everyone. Free of cost make this reachable for everyone even user is a student or a commercial user.
What do you dislike about the product?
Due to open source sometime its documentation was not clear for the unexpected issues and less software was available for this to use. rest I appreciate all the features and support.
What problems is the product solving and how is that benefiting you?
For a startup, it solves a big problem of cost. Free licenses make it helpful in the growth of a startup office. N number of systems can install ubuntu at 0 costs.

Great Distro for Coding and Personal Use
What do you like best about the product?
First and foremost is an open-source and free operating system that provides services and features such as Virtualization, Stability, Patch Management and Intuitive GUI, plus agility and great community support.
What do you dislike about the product?
Although it is such a great operating system still there are room for improvement in supporting more drivers and games, meaning that the graphics part of the OS needs more work.
What problems is the product solving and how is that benefiting you?
I use Ubuntu for programming plus personal use of my Desktop, so far so good, new versions and updates plus great community support keep me on track with this OS.
Recommendations to others considering the product:
Try it for yourself and enjoy the smoothness of this OS, after all, it depends on your needs and preferences but for coding and personal use, Ubuntu is my favorite.
